Getting started with Figma
Figma is the new primary tool to design, collaborate, and share designs. It's a cloud-based design tool that is available on web browsers and desktop applications for macOS and Windows. Figma offers helpful tutorials to get to know the tool and start using it.
You can access Figma directly in your browser by visiting and logging into Figma.com, or download the desktop app
- For TELUS Digital designers and content practitioners, contact your team's Design Lead to be invited to your respective Team Space
- For vendors or designers outside of TELUS Digital, we will provide exported Figma files for your use in your own design tools

TDS libraries in Figma
The TELUS Design System are available as three Figma libraries:
- TDS Core Styles - (Download the local .fig file)
- TDS Core Components - {Download the local .fig file)
- TDS Core Icons - (Download the local .fig file)
Once you have access to your team space, you'll be able to access the TDS libraries using the Asset's panel on the left sidebar. You can pull in components and icons, and apply typography and colour styles. Check out the guide to libraries in Figma for more information and detailed instructions on using libraries.
TDS UI Sticker Sheet
The TDS UI Sticker Sheet provides a consolidated view of the available TDS Core components as well as a guide to using the TDS Core styles. (Download the local .fig file)
Fonts
TELUS' primary typeface is Helvetica Neue which is available as a system font on Mac OS X 10.7 Lion and later. No other fonts are needed to use the TDS libraries in Figma or TDS UI sticker sheet.

Releases
The TELUS Design System team often makes design improvements to the TDS libraries and TDS UI sticker sheet. You can access the version history of each library and design file as long as you have view access to the file.
When TDS makes releases you will get notified the next time you open Figma. You'll get a notification letting you know that there are updates available within your file.
